Spirituality therapists in Narragansett, Rhode Island Statistics
Spirituality therapists in Narragansett, Rhode Island average 18 years of experience and charge around $207 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(58%), Existential / Humanistic Therapy (49%), and Psychodynamic Therapy (47%).
